Self-Made Men
Individuals who achieve success or wealth through their own efforts rather than by inheritance or privilege.
Shays's Rebellion
An armed uprising in 1786-1787 by American farmers against state and local enforcement of tax collections and judgments for debt.
Iroquois League
A historically powerful and influential confederation of six Native American tribes in the northeastern United States, also known as the Haudenosaunee or Six Nations.
American Patriots
Colonists of the Thirteen Colonies who rebelled against British control during the American Revolution.
